The president of LaLiga, Javier Thebes, has undertaken several 'wars' in the last year. One of them with the FC Barcelona by the fair play financial that governs to the Spanish tournament, but also has included to the culés, beside Real Madrid in his attacks by the project of the Superliga.

Besides, the lawyer explained publicly does several months his intention to sue to the PSG by the multimillionaire renewal of Kylian Mbappé. Of way almost immediate, transacted three months ago a complaint against the French team, when understanding that it surpassed the limits of the fair play of the UEFA. Of the same way, the president of the League sued to the Manchester City by the signing of Erling Haaland.

Thebes declared them the 'war' publicly to both teams, sustained by economies of Middle East: "The consent this type of operations out of market is an atrocity. It is more dangerous that the SuperLiga", aseveró the director of the League. However, to Thebes has touched him lose, at least for the moment.

As it informs 'RMC Sport', the judge would have filed the three causes of the League against Paris Saint Germain. These consist in requesting the derogation of the agreement of Mbappé to the Minister of Sports, the request so that the League of Professional Football (LFP) contact with the National Direction of Control and Management (DNCG) so that it inspect the accounts of the Parisian picture, and the suspension of the agreement of Mbappé after requesting it to the LFP.

However, after having been object of surveillance by part of the UEFA because of his losses, the PSG and also the Marseilles are exposed now to sanctions more direct. As it informs this Friday 'L'Équipe', the financial organism of the European Confederation (ICFC) has sent an agreement of settlement to both clubs. These sanctions are of economic character, but could be it to sportive level if they do not change the things in the next seasons.

Figures alucinantes

The operation to extend the bond of Mbappé with the Parisian picture has brushed the science fiction. The president of the PSG agreed an agreement with his forward by a total of 435 millions, as it informed 'The Republic' in the beginning of the summer. The forward of 23 years will earn 100 million gross euros by each one of the three seasons in the Park of the Princes.

Besides, the Monaco will earn 35 'kilos' by a clause of the past signing of Mbappé by the PSG in 2017. To complete his new agreement, Mbappé received other 100 millions like premium of renewal after signing his new agreement in May, declining the option of fichar by the Real Madrid.
